Waldman MD, JD, in The Hip and Pelvis, 2024 Differential Diagnosis. Femoral neuropathy is often misdiagnosed as lumbar radiculopathy, trochanteric bursitis, meralgia paresthetica, or primary hip pathology. Radiographs of the hip and electromyography can distinguish femoral neuropathy from radiculopathy or pain emanating from the hip. colorado plan review fee schedule

WebFigure.1 Muscular Branches of Femoral Nerve. The femoral nerve is the largest nerve of the lumbar plexus. It originates from the dorsal divisions of the L2-L4 ventral rami. It has a role in motor and sensory processing in the lower limbs. It controls: The major hip flexor muscles, as well as knee extension muscles.
